The new M4 is far from a concept. Sure that is the official title of the car they have shown us but in reality the car is pretty well completely finalized now for production. Every little detail is known and BMW knows exactly how fast they have been able to get the car around the Nordeschleife.

Anyway, if this is a Sportauto time, my guess, in part based on a simple power to weight regression analysis is 7:5X. If the car comes with super aggressive, near race rubber and BMW throws a very fast driver at the task they should be able to break in to the 7:4X range. Quite tough to make any more decisive predictions than that.

I beleave nothing more what I heard from insider sources !!!

The rumored V6 is most probably reality and could be tested in the F8x-Mules, but not for the M3/M4 itself.
On the other hand the rumored weight savings are much lower than this sources said ... under 1500kg/3306lbs DIN-weight is not so spectacular as under 1500kg/3306lbs EU-weight as claimed by this sources.

I think an ~7.40 NOS-time on sport tyres should be possible, because nearly all experts claims the M3(?)/M4 reached the fastest BMW time on NOS ever. But 7.32 on winter tyres and not perfect conditions seems nearly impossible .. also with the possible 450hp of an Competition Package.

An 7.12 seems to be the same BS as an hardcore M4 with 500+hp ... if this S55 engine could produce 500 and more hp, it would be sure that also the regular M3/M4 would get at least 450+hp !!!
